Definition
Montgomery is usually a proper noun, most commonly the name of a city in Alabama, USA, or a surname. The exact meaning depends on the context, because it refers to a specific person or place rather than a general thing.
Usage & Nuances
Because it is a proper noun, 'Montgomery' is capitalized. Learners should not treat it like a common noun with an article unless the sentence structure requires one, and pronunciation may vary slightly by speaker.
